Lazard Asset Management LLC lifted its holdings in Asbury Automotive Group, Inc. (NYSE:ABG - Free Report) by 42.1%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 4,055 shares of the company's stock after buying an additional 1,201 shares during the quarter. Lazard Asset Management LLC's holdings in Asbury Automotive Group were worth $985,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Asbury Automotive Group Stock Down 0.6%
Shares of NYSE ABG opened at $233.64 on Tuesday. The company has a current ratio of 1.20, a quick ratio of 0.41 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.98. The stock has a market capitalization of $4.59 billion, a PE ratio of 10.86 and a beta of 0.98. Asbury Automotive Group, Inc. has a 12-month low of $201.68 and a 12-month high of $312.56. The stock's fifty day simple moving average is $225.56 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$249.38.
Asbury Automotive Group (NYSE:ABG -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Tuesday, April 29th. The company reported $6.82 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$6.84 by ($0.02). Asbury Automotive Group had a return on equity of 16.29% and a net margin of 2.50%. The business had revenue of $4.15 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$4.31 billion.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$7.21 earnings per share. The firm's quarterly revenue was down 1.3%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, analysts expect that Asbury Automotive Group, Inc. will post 26.28 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Asbury Automotive Group,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ates as an automotive retailer in the United States. It offers a range of automotive products and services, including new and used vehicles; and vehicle repair and maintenance services, replacement parts, and collision repair services.
